Screen Shot 2017-07-26 at 9.07.52 am.jpgThe Portfolio Project has now partnered with YouthWorx Melbourne, a registered training organisation that provides cert level courses and work experience to disadvantaged youth in multimedia and creative industries.

The Portfolio Project will go in and train young people accessing the services at YouthWorx as part of a paid work placement for the young people.

The first real project? The redesign of the YouthWorx website which the young people will be taught UX and web design skills to begin with then later the curriculum will expand to workshops and different aspects of the creative industry.

Unknown.jpgSays Duncan Mah, co-founder, The Portfolio Project: “The other exciting development we have is that The Portfolio Project have gone global.”

The new website is a portal where training to disadvantaged youth and young people with a disability can be done online and they can be trained in creative skills via the online portal through Skype anywhere in Australia and anywhere around the world.
